Edina vs Rochester: Occupational Therapist Salary (2026)
Compare occupational therapist salaries between Edina, MN and Rochester, MN. All figures are 2026 estimates projected from BLS 2025 data.
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Metric | Edina, MN | Rochester, MN |
|---|---|---|
| Median Salary | $87,448 | $87,601▲ |
| Hourly Rate | $42.04 | $42.11▲ |
| Entry Level (P10) | $63,017 | $84,396▲ |
| 25th Percentile | $71,661 | $86,467▲ |
| 75th Percentile | $103,063 | $104,410▲ |
| Top Earner (P90) | $116,205▲ | $112,469 |
| Total Employed | 11 | 300▲ |
Verdict
Rochester, MN offers better overall compensation for occupational therapists, winning 3 out of 4 metrics compared to Edina.
The salary gap between Edina and Rochester is $153 (0.17%). Rochester's median is -15.28% compared to the US national median of $103,400.

Cost-of-Living Adjusted Comparison
After cost-of-living adjustment, Rochester ($96,455 effective) pays 8.64% more than Edina ($88,780 effective).
Cost-of-living adjustment: salary × (100 / CoL index). Index of 100 = national average.

Historical Salary Growth Comparison
Based on B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, occupational therapist salaries in Edina grew 1.3% from 2024 to 2025, compared to 15.5% growth in Rochester over the same period.
Edina, MN
$83,798 (2024) → $84,852 (2025)
Rochester, MN
$73,620 (2019) → $85,000 (2025)

Methodology & Data Source
All salary figures are 2026 projections based on BLS OEWS May 2025 data. A 3.06% CAGR (derived from 6-year national BLS trends) was applied to estimate current compensation. Cost-of-living adjustments use BEA Regional Price Parity data. Actual salaries vary by employer, certifications, and experience.
